So, what happens if your suitcase is over 50 lbs?

The standard overweight fee for normal bags (your first two) is $100 if the bag is between 50.1 LBS and 70 LBS, and $200 if the bag is between 70.1 LBS and 100 LBS. Bags over 100 LBS are not allowed. If you are bringing more than two bags and are not military or business/first class, you will face additional charges.

Moreover, Your airline immediately sees dollar signs when you check a bag. For example, American Airlines charges just $25 for a checked bag on a domestic flight, but the fee quadruples if your bag weighs more than 50 pounds and doubles again to $200 if it’s over 70 pounds.
